Dangerous Fake GTA 6 Leak Site Drains Crypto Wallets 2026

Malwarebytes uncovered a fake GTA 6 leak site posing as a fan countdown offering a leaked copy for $50 or 1 SOL. The page hides two drainers targeting Solana and EVM chains including Ethereum and BNB Chain, risking full wallet loss for users approving transactions.

ChainCatcher reports that, according to a Malwarebytes report, scammers are exploiting the popularity of GTA 6 to create phishing websites claiming to sell a leaked version of the game for $50 or 1 SOL, tricking visitors into connecting their wallets and signing malicious transactions.
